# Break-Glass: Catalog Cache Invalidation

Scope: the Pinrow product catalog at Veldstone Retail. If stale prices persist after a purge and the Hollowmere invalidation queue is wedged, use break-glass to flush the edge tier directly. Contractors: get verbal sign-off from the catalog lead first. Steps: open the Hollowmere admin shell, select emergency-flush, confirm the tenant, and run it once — repeated flushes thrash the origin. Access is logged and expires after 20 minutes. Unseal the admin shell with the passphrase below.

recovery phrase for kahop-tajog: istix-casvan

Ticket: Stabilize Tollgate payments integration tests

Welcome aboard. The Tollgate service's integration suite fails intermittently, mostly in the capture-and-settle scenarios. We believe the test containers share a clock-skewed database fixture, causing idempotency-key collisions. Your task: isolate the fixtures, add retry diagnostics, and produce a flakiness report over 50 CI runs. Do not disable any test without written approval. This ticket requires sign-off before merge, and the approver's name appears below.

account owner for bawip-tahag: Raleth Quenok

// BASELINE_PATH points to the static-analysis baseline used by the Lintwharf
// scanner in the Quillbrook monorepo. New findings are compared against this
// file; anything already listed is suppressed so legacy debt doesn't block
// merges. Never edit the baseline by hand — regenerate it with the refresh
// task and review the diff carefully, since silently baselining a real defect
// has bitten us before. The baseline was last regenerated from the build
// identified directly below.

session token of tajef-bageg = htk21_5d90d574934f3ccae6437